ENALAPRIL MALEATE- ENALAPRIL MALEATE TABLET NCS HEALTHCARE OF KY, INC DBA VANGARD LABS ---------- ENALAPRIL MALEATE Product Information ENALAPRIL MALEATE TABLETS, USP Rx only USE IN PREGNANCY WHEN USED IN PREGNANCY DURING THE SECOND AND THIRD TRIMESTERS, ACE INHIBITORS CAN CAUSE INJURY AND EVEN DEATH TO THE DEVELOPING FETUS. When pregnancy is detected, enalapril maleate should be discontinued as soon as possible. See WARNINGS, _Fetal / Neonatal Morbidity and Mortality._ DESCRIPTION Enalapril maleate is the maleate salt of enalapril, the ethyl ester of a long-acting angiotensin converting enzyme inhibitor, enalaprilat. Enalapril maleate is chemically described as L-Proline,1-[N-[1- (ethoxycarbonyl)-3-phenylpropyl]-L-alanyl]- , (S)-, (Z)-2-butenedioate (1:1). Its molecular formula is, C H N O ·C H O , and its structural formula is: Enalapril maleate is a white to off-white, crystalline powder with a molecular weight of 492.53. It is sparingly soluble in water, soluble in ethanol, and freely soluble in methanol. Enalapril is a pro-drug; following oral administration, it is bioactivated by hydrolysis of the ethyl ester to enalaprilat, which is the active angiotensin converting enzyme inhibitor. Enalapril maleate is supplied as 2.5 mg, 5 mg,10 mg and 20 mg tablets for oral administration. In addition, each tablet contains the following inactive ingredients: hypromellose, anhydrous lactose, corn starch, stearic acid and talc. The 10 mg and 20 mg tablets also contain iron oxides. CLINICAL PHARMACOLOGY MECHANISM OF ACTION Enalapril, after hydrolysis to enalaprilat, inhibits angiotensin-converting enzyme (ACE) in human subjects and animals. ACE is a peptidyl dipeptidase that catalyzes the conversion of angiotensin I to the vasoconstrictor substance, angiotensin II. Angiotensin II also stimulates aldosterone secretion by the adrenal cortex. The beneficial effects of enalapril in hypertension and heart failure appear to result primarily from suppression of the renin -angiotensin-aldosterone system.
